Background:
|
Regulations require Districts participating in the National School Lunch Program (NSLP) to ensure sufficient funds are provided to the nonprofit school food service account for meals served to students not eligible for free or reduced-price meals. One way to meet this requirement is through prices charged for paid meals. The purpose of this requirement, Paid Lunch Equity (PLE), is to increase paid meal prices to be more equal with funds brought in from free and reduced-price meal reimbursements. |

Summary:
|
In order to comply with the PLE requirement for the NSLP, the District needs to increase the paid lunch price from $3.15 to $3.25 for the 2023-24 school year. By remaining on NSLP, it is expected that paid lunch prices will increase each year. While the price charged for a paid breakfast is not tied to the PLE requirement, we reviewed this price and determined it is reasonable to increase paid breakfast price from $1.25 to $1.50. We will be entering the final year of a 5-year contract with Organic Life for the 2023-24 school year. This will require us to conduct a new procurement for a food service management contract for the 2024-25 school year. This process will begin in August and will include discussions around the structure of the procurement and whether we choose to remove the high schools from the NSLP. |
